Where is the Simas family from?

You can see how Simas families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Simas family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1871 and 1920. The most Simas families were found in USA in 1920. In 1911 there were 7 Simas families living in Saskatchewan. This was about 88% of all the recorded Simas's in Canada. Saskatchewan had the highest population of Simas families in 1911.

What did your Simas 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Farmer and Housekeeper were the top reported jobs for men and women in the USA named Simas. 19% of Simas men worked as a Farmer and 13% of Simas women worked as a Housekeeper. Some less common occupations for Americans named Simas were Salesman and Cloth Inspector. .

What is the average Simas lifespan?

Between 1945 and 2004, in the United States, Simas life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1961, and highest in 1989. The average life expectancy for Simas in 1945 was 41, and 77 in 2004.
